The Head and Shoulders I warned about earlier has completed so here is what I see happening now... The H&S has a rising neckline which typically indicates that the pattern will not retrace to its full potential. I do expect a bearish correction but we have a few weaker support lines to remember. One Is the target line from the inverse H&S right around the $484 mark. Then we have the 50 EMA and the 100 EMA's to offer support. I say weak support because those levels have only been tested once maybe twice so they are not as strong as we'd like, but the way I see this scenario moving forward is displayed by the chart above. So what I see now is that the Head of the Head and Shoulders pattern (light red) looks to be the real top of the cup forming the Cup and Handles neckline. I have extended the cup to be bigger to reflect this. Then I see the head and shoulders being the transition that forms the handle. Remember, the handle can retrace to 50% of the cup before it is no longer valid. I still see a C&H forming here I think I was just a bit early calling the neckline. If we retrace to the full potential of the H&S then we will form a perfect handle for that larger cup and then we should have enough momentum to start the next bull run. I have changed the color of the target to Yellow because I want you to remember that this is a Potential C&H, it is not yet a true C&H. We don't trade until we have confirmation.
